Types of Metal Benders
Understanding the various types of metal benders is essential for selecting the right one for your project, whether you're bending sheet metal, tubes, or pipes. The press brake is a go-to choice for bending sheet metal. It's a staple in fabrication shops and manufacturing facilities, where precision and repeatability are key.
When you need to shape tubes or pipes, a tube bender is your ally. This tool is crucial in industries like automotive and construction, where the integrity of the bend can make or break a project.
If you're aiming to create smooth curves and circles in pieces of metal, you'll likely turn to a roll bender. This tool is a favorite in HVAC and metal fabrication, as well as in the creation of artistic metalwork.
For more complex tasks, the English wheel comes into play. It enables you to form smooth, compound curves in sheet metal, making it indispensable for automotive restoration and custom metal fabrication.
Lastly, when precision is paramount, and distortion isn't an option, a mandrel bender is the tool to reach for. Its design is perfect for industries that demand the highest standards, like aerospace and high-end automotive manufacturing.

Incremental Bending Strategies
To master the art of shaping metal with precision, it's essential to understand incremental bending strategies, which allow for the creation of complex forms through a series of calculated, minor adjustments. Here's a concise guide to help you execute these advanced techniques:
- Begin by accurately measuring and marking the metal piece where bends are required, ensuring you account for material springback.
- Make a series of small bends rather than one large bend to avoid over-stressing the metal, using tools like bending brakes for consistency.
- Continually check your work against the design specifications after each incremental bend to maintain precision.
- Utilize press brakes or slip rolls for more complex bends, adjusting settings incrementally to achieve the exact curvature needed.
Heat-Assisted Bending Methods
When working with stubborn or thick metals, heat-assisted bending methods can be a game-changer, allowing you to mold the material with greater ease and precision.
Utilizing a torch to heat the metal locally, torch bending targets specific areas to achieve the bends you need.
For an even more precise approach, induction bending harnesses electromagnetic induction, heating the metal uniformly and enabling controlled, accurate bends.

Personal Protective Equipment
To ensure your safety during metalworking, it's essential to don appropriate personal protective equipment. Here's your quick safety checklist:
- Eye Protection: Always wear safety glasses to shield your eyes from flying debris and sparks.
- Hand Safety: Slip on a pair of durable gloves to protect your hands from cuts and burns.
- Footwear: Steel-toed boots are crucial to guard your feet against heavy falling objects.
- Respiratory Safety: Use a mask or respirator to prevent inhaling metal dust or fumes.
